QA Engineer Job at The San Francisco Standard, Remote

TGc5WkU5dTJ0bE9LREVzcnpIWDdsQXRISnc9PQ==
  • The San Francisco Standard
  • Remote

Job Description

The San Francisco Standard is seeking a QA Engineer to help ensure the quality and reliability of our modern web applications. The ideal candidate will combine technical expertise with a methodical approach to quality assurance and testing automation.

We're looking for a QA Engineer with a proven track record who takes pride in crafting robust testing frameworks and ensuring exceptional product quality. In this role, you'll architect automated testing systems, create comprehensive test plans, and strategically perform manual validation to ensure product quality. Reporting to the Director of Product, you will work with cross-functional teams to implement and maintain testing infrastructure for a high-profile, large-scale content platform with a devoted digital audience.

As a digital-native news publisher, maintaining high quality standards across our tech stack is essential to fostering trust and loyalty in our growing audience. We are undertaking an ambitious systems modernization project this year, and we need a dedicated testing professional to ensure reliability and performance in all phases of the development process.

For this role, we're considering candidates who live in continental Europe and are willing to work hours that partially overlap with our product team based in the western United States, roughly between 13:00 and 21:00 GMT. 

Responsibilities

  • Design, implement, and maintain comprehensive automated testing strategies using Jest and Cypress
  • Develop and execute end-to-end test scenarios that simulate real user interactions with our CMS and public-facing applications
  • Write and maintain unit tests with Jest, including snapshot testing for React components
  • Create and maintain a rigorous smoke test pipeline which should catch production artifacts
  • Implement integration tests to ensure seamless functionality across different system components
  • Create and maintain testing documentation, including test plans, test cases, and testing standards
  • Collaborate with developers to ensure proper test coverage for new features and bug fixes
  • Set up and maintain continuous integration pipelines for automated testing
  • Strategically conduct manual QA validation testing when appropriate
  • Monitor and analyze test results to identify patterns and potential issues
  • Participate in code reviews with a focus on testability and quality
  • Work with the team to establish quality metrics and testing best practices
  • Assist in performance testing and optimization
  • Investigate and document bug reports, ensuring proper reproduction steps
  • Maintain testing environments and test data

Qualifications:

  • Minimum 3 years of professional experience with:
    • Jest testing framework and snapshot testing
    • Cypress for end-to-end testing
    • JavaScript/TypeScript testing practices
    • React component testing
  • Proven experience in:
    • Writing and maintaining large-scale test suites
    • Setting up and managing continuous integration/deployment pipelines
    • Working with Git version control
    • Test automation in an Agile environment
  • Strong understanding of:
    • Modern web technologies (React, Next.js, TypeScript)
    • Testing principles and methodologies
    • Web application architecture
    • Performance testing concepts
    • RESTful APIs and GraphQL testing
    • Testing best practices and patterns
  • A mastery of these soft skills:
    • Strong analytical and problem-solving abilities
    • Excellent attention to detail
    • Strong written and verbal communication skills in English
    • Ability to work independently and as part of a team
    • Good time management and organizational skills

Preferred Qualifications

  • 5+ years of QA automation experience in production environments
  • Experience with performance testing tools and methodologies
  • Familiarity with accessibility testing
  • Experience with visual regression testing
  • Knowledge of security testing principles
  • Experience with WordPress testing
  • Background in news media or content management systems
  • Experience with Docker and containerized testing environments

This role is for a self-employed contractor working remotely. Compensation packages are based on several factors that are unique to each candidate. Monetary compensation will be paid in US dollars, with range of compensation of $2500-3500 weekly.

We encourage you to apply even if you don't fit the preferred qualifications of the job.

Job Tags

Remote job, Contract work, For contractors, Self employment,

Similar Jobs

ECLARO

Motion Graphic Designer Job at ECLARO

 ...Job Role: Marketing Graphic Designer: Work Location: 51 Madison Avenue, Manhattan, NY 10010 Working Hours: Candidates should be flexible...  ...in office This is 70% General Graphic Designing and 30% Motion Graphics Role Overview: ~ Candidate must have previous... 

Flamingo

Professional House Cleaner - New York Job at Flamingo

 ...residential apartment buildings including resident events, fitness classes, and concierge services, including house cleaning! We are looking for experienced house cleaners who want to offer their exceptional services to our customers! Qualifications: ~ Be a... 

ABGi USA

Partner and Alliances Sales Associate Job at ABGi USA

 ...Partner and Alliances Sales Associate - ABGI USA - Houston Join...  ...educational background with internships providing with strong sales,...  ...Perks and Benefits ~ Full Medical, Dental, Vision, STD, LTD, Critical...  ...and Vested Day 1!~ Paid Parking and Onsite Gym ~ Travel... 

LanceSoft

Travel RDN - Registered Dietitian Nutritionist - $2,266 per week Job at LanceSoft

 ...LanceSoft is seeking a travel RDN - Registered Dietitian Nutritionist for a travel job in Elizabethtown, Kentucky. Job Description & Requirements ~ Specialty: RDN - Registered Dietitian Nutritionist ~ Discipline: Allied Health Professional ~ Start Date: 05/... 

Focus Staff

Travel RDN - Registered Dietitian Nutritionist - $2,166 per week Job at Focus Staff

 ...Focus Staff is seeking a travel RDN - Registered Dietitian Nutritionist for a travel job in Peridot, Arizona. Job Description & Requirements ~ Specialty: RDN - Registered Dietitian Nutritionist ~ Discipline: Allied Health Professional ~ Start Date: 05/05/20...